Why wall panels work well in office meeting spaces

In many office fit-outs, plain painted walls can leave meeting rooms feeling temporary or disconnected from the rest of the workplace. Wood-look wall panels help define the room more clearly, add visual warmth, and create a more deliberate backdrop for screens, lighting, and everyday collaboration. For teams comparing finishes in Canada, this is often a practical way to improve the room without relying on complicated decorative elements.

Keeping the wall language consistent across adjacent rooms

One of the strengths of this office project is consistency. The conference room uses full-height wood-look wall panels to wrap the meeting space, while the executive office introduces lighter panels and vertical slat details in a more focused work setting. That makes the whole office feel more intentional instead of treating each room as a separate finish decision.

Details commercial project teams should review early

Before ordering office wall panels, it is worth checking how the layout works around door frames, screens, ceiling grids, lighting, and built-in cabinetry. These details affect how clean the room looks once the project is complete. In meeting rooms especially, alignment and transition conditions are often more noticeable because the walls stay in view during long presentations and video calls.
